Description
Request for Information (RFI) - The Space and Naval Warfare Systems Center Charleston (SSC CH) seeks sources and information concerning contactless biometric technology for the application of controlling access to facilities and information technology networks for the Department of Defense Community. Information on State of the Art (SOFA) biometric contactless systems/equipment meeting International Organization for Standards (ISO) 14443 and 15693 is requested. Data on new or emerging technologies capable of supporting the goals of contactless biometric access control is also needed to assist planning of future work in this area. Requirement: Specific technical areas of interest for systems and technology include: (1) Support Encryption - symmetric and/or asymmetric for data that resides on card and for the transmission of all critical data passing between reader and card. (2) Contactless Biometric Readers that support multiple standards (ISO 14443 Type A and Type B and ISO 15693). (3) Contactless Biometric Readers that support Numeric Pin Pad and ISO 14443 and 15693 , (4) Ability of Contactless Biometric Readers to work on Legacy Electronic Security Systems 5) Read and Write distances between the card and the biometric reader. Demonstration of contactless biometric technology: We are interested in a potential demonstration of this technology to achieve a significant increase in integrated functionality or operational performance in an operational setting. Therefore, we request information on (1) Current SOFA Products, (2) Available and emerging products/technologies, (3) Near term research and beta products that are potential candidates for investment. Submittals: Interested parties should submit (1) Technical information and materials regarding existing and proposed products, technologies, and research. This includes, but is not limited to, current and/or projected performance capabilities and potential delivery schedules; (2) A brief description of relevant and recently completed efforts; (3) Pertinent company information, including contact person, phone number and email address. No part of the submittal will be returned. Responses to this RFI should be mailed to: SPAWARSYSCEN Charleston, Attn: Code 0217/744, P.O. Box 190022, N. Charleston, SC, 29419-9022. Please provide 3 copies of any hardcopy items. This RFI is for planning purposes only, and should not be construed as a Request for Proposal (RFP) or solicitation of an offer. The Government does not intend to award a contract on the basis of this RFI or otherwise pay for the information solicited. Responders will not be provided any written correspondence. The purpose of this request for information is to determine if the technology is viable for use.
